/illumos-gate/usr/src/uts/common/io/scsi/adapters/lmrc/ |
H A D | lmrc_ddi.c | 317 lmrc->l_dip = dip; in lmrc_ctrl_attach() 449 ddi_fm_service_impact(lmrc->l_dip, DDI_SERVICE_LOST); in lmrc_ctrl_attach() 501 ddi_remove_minor_node(lmrc->l_dip, lmrc->l_iocname); in lmrc_cleanup() 584 ddi_soft_state_free(lmrc_state, ddi_get_instance(lmrc->l_dip)); in lmrc_cleanup() 605 if (ddi_dev_regsize(lmrc->l_dip, regno, ®size) != DDI_SUCCESS) in lmrc_regs_init() 609 dev_err(lmrc->l_dip, CE_WARN, "reg %d size (%ld) is too small", in lmrc_regs_init() 614 if (ddi_regs_map_setup(lmrc->l_dip, regno, &lmrc->l_regmap, 0, 0, in lmrc_regs_init() 617 dev_err(lmrc->l_dip, CE_WARN, in lmrc_regs_init() 650 ret = ddi_intr_get_supported_types(lmrc->l_dip, in lmrc_add_intrs() 653 dev_err(lmrc->l_dip, CE_WARN, in lmrc_add_intrs() [all …]
|
H A D | lmrc.c | 160 ddi_fm_service_impact(lmrc->l_dip, DDI_SERVICE_LOST); in lmrc_intr_ack() 356 dev_err(lmrc->l_dip, CE_WARN, "!command failed, status = %x, " in lmrc_process_mpt_pkt() 490 dev_err(lmrc->l_dip, CE_PANIC, in lmrc_process_replies() 608 dev_err(lmrc->l_dip, CE_PANIC, in lmrc_process_mptmfi_passthru() 685 dev_err(lmrc->l_dip, CE_WARN, in lmrc_poll_mfi() 729 dev_err(lmrc->l_dip, CE_WARN, "!%s: blocked command timeout " in lmrc_wait_mfi() 775 dev_err(lmrc->l_dip, CE_WARN, in lmrc_issue_blocked_mfi() 945 dev_err(lmrc->l_dip, CE_WARN, "diag unlock failed"); in lmrc_hard_reset() 995 dev_err(lmrc->l_dip, CE_WARN, in lmrc_reset_ctrl() 1001 dev_err(lmrc->l_dip, CE_WARN, "resetting..."); in lmrc_reset_ctrl() [all …]
|
H A D | lmrc_scsa.c | 545 dev_err(lmrc->l_dip, CE_WARN, "!target reset timed out, " in lmrc_tran_abort() 581 dev_err(lmrc->l_dip, CE_WARN, in lmrc_tran_reset() 732 tran = scsi_hba_tran_alloc(lmrc->l_dip, SCSI_HBA_CANSLEEP); in lmrc_hba_attach() 734 dev_err(lmrc->l_dip, CE_WARN, "!scsi_hba_tran_alloc failed"); in lmrc_hba_attach() 761 if (scsi_hba_attach_setup(lmrc->l_dip, &tran_attr, tran, in lmrc_hba_attach() 767 if (scsi_hba_iport_register(lmrc->l_dip, LMRC_IPORT_RAID) != in lmrc_hba_attach() 771 if (scsi_hba_iport_register(lmrc->l_dip, LMRC_IPORT_PHYS) != in lmrc_hba_attach() 778 dev_err(lmrc->l_dip, CE_WARN, in lmrc_hba_attach() 791 (void) scsi_hba_detach(lmrc->l_dip); in lmrc_hba_detach()
|
H A D | lmrc_ioctl.c | 107 ret = ddi_prop_lookup_int_array(DDI_DEV_T_ANY, lmrc->l_dip, 0, "reg", in lmrc_drv_ioctl_pci_info() 119 if (pci_config_setup(lmrc->l_dip, &pcih) != DDI_SUCCESS) in lmrc_drv_ioctl_pci_info() 128 ddi_fm_service_impact(lmrc->l_dip, DDI_SERVICE_LOST); in lmrc_drv_ioctl_pci_info() 178 dev_err(lmrc->l_dip, CE_WARN, in lmrc_drv_ioctl() 287 dev_err(lmrc->l_dip, CE_WARN, in lmrc_mfi_ioctl() 396 dev_err(lmrc->l_dip, CE_WARN, in lmrc_mfi_ioctl() 447 dev_err(lmrc->l_dip, CE_WARN, "!unimplemented ioctl: MFI AEN"); in lmrc_mfi_aen_ioctl()
|
H A D | lmrc_phys.c | 83 dev_err(lmrc->l_dip, CE_WARN, in lmrc_get_pdmap() 157 dev_err(lmrc->l_dip, CE_WARN, in lmrc_complete_sync_pdmap() 342 dev_err(lmrc->l_dip, CE_WARN, in lmrc_phys_update_tgtmap() 467 dev_err(lmrc->l_dip, CE_WARN, "!Failed to get PD list."); in lmrc_phys_attach()
|
H A D | lmrc_raid.c | 92 dev_err(lmrc->l_dip, CE_WARN, in lmrc_get_raidmap() 207 dev_err(lmrc->l_dip, CE_WARN, in lmrc_complete_sync_raidmap() 531 dev_err(lmrc->l_dip, CE_WARN, in lmrc_raid_update_tgtmap() 739 dev_err(lmrc->l_dip, CE_WARN, "!RAID map setup failed."); in lmrc_raid_attach() 747 dev_err(lmrc->l_dip, CE_WARN, "!Failed to get LD list."); in lmrc_raid_attach()
|
H A D | lmrc.h | 170 dev_info_t *l_dip; member
|